How a dehumidifier works in Hatley St George

The idea is simple: the unit draws in damp air, the moisture condenses and collects in a tank (or drains away), and drier air is pushed back into the room. For a cellar or cold room in Hatley St George, you'll want a model suited to cool spaces and matched to the volume you're drying.

Dehumidifier hire prices in Hatley St George

To dry out a damp room or cellar in Hatley St George, hire works out at a few pounds to £25 a day depending on capacity — much cheaper than buying an industrial unit that then sits idle in the garage.

Which dehumidifier should I hire for damp and mould?

Ventilate, fix any obvious source of water, then run a properly sized dehumidifier. Within a few days the smell and the damp drop noticeably in Hatley St George.

Will it push my electricity bill up?

It depends on the model and how long it runs, but you're typically looking at a few pence to around £1 of electricity per day of use.

How quickly will it dry my room?

It depends how wet things are: a damp room clears in days, while drying-out works in Hatley St George may need a week or more of continuous running.

Will a dehumidifier get rid of black mould?

A dehumidifier tackles the root: the excess moisture mould needs to grow. Clean the existing mould off, then keep the air dry and it struggles to come back in Hatley St George.
